SCCM 2012 PXE 问题

SCCM 2012 PXE 问题

我们遇到了一个持续了大约 10 天的问题,由于我们最近没有对大量 PC 进行映像处理,所以我自己并没有注意到这个问题。

本质上,我们在尝试启动客户端时收到“E53 - 未收到启动文件名”错误。Wireshark 显示分发点接收 BOOTP 流量,因此我倾向于认为这不是网络问题(其他一切都没有改变)

接下来 - 我们启用 WDS 的两台主机似乎都运行良好。没有进行任何更改,服务器上没有错误,事件日志显示 PXE 服务启动正常,尽管两天前,两台主机的 WDS 日志中每 15-25 分钟都会同时出现以下条目 8 次:

提供商 WDSTFTP 打开了一个端点。

随后还有 8 个

提供商 WDSTFTP 关闭了一个端点。

类型:UDP

地址:(随机UDP端口)

然后,我尝试查看分发点上的 PXE 日志,但它们只能追溯到一天前。我稍后会发布这些内容,但以下是一切正常时我们通常在 smsdpusage.log 中看到的内容:

  • 无法打开注册表项 Software\Microsoft\CCM。返回代码 [80070002]。客户端 HTTPS 状态为未知。
  • 从 C:\inetpub\logs\LogFiles\W3SVC1\ex170410.log 收集统计信息
  • 向 MP 报告状态消息 0x00000000
  • 报告正文:ID=“0”类型=“903”IDType=“0”/>严重性=“0”/>计数=“4”>41635515797198720 SMS_Distribution_Point_Monitoring

10天前我们开始看到以下情况:

  • 无法打开注册表项 Software\Microsoft\CCM。返回代码 [80070002]。客户端 HTTPS 状态为未知。从 C:\inetpub\logs\LogFiles\W3SVC1\u_ex170415.log 收集统计信息
  • 报告状态消息 0x00000003到 MP
  • 报告正文:0000
  • 回复没有消息头标记
  • 从远程 DP 向站点服务器发送 DP 状态消息时出错http://CM12-DP.域名.代码 0x80004005

我不知道 3 的代码是什么意思,但是我们的 SMSPXE.log 看起来像是不断重复的样子。

  • RequestMPKeyInformation:Send() 失败。
  • 无法获取 MP 的信息:http://CM12-MP.域名。 80004005.
  • 回复没有消息头标记
  • PXE::MP_LookupDevice 失败;0x80004005
  • RequestMPKeyInformation:Send() 失败。
  • 无法获取 MP 的信息:http://CM12-MP.域名。 80004005.
  • 回复没有消息头标记
  • 无法发送状态消息(80004005)
  • 发送状态消息失败
  • PXE::MP_ReportStatus 失败;0x80004005
  • PXE 提供程序无法处理消息。
  • 未指定的错误(错误:80004005;来源:Windows)
  • D4:3D:7E:6B:0E:9B,00000000-0000-0000-0000-D43D7E6B0E9B:未提供服务。

我们尝试过重启服务和系统,但目前还没有成功。我的前任在我来之前就设置了我们的 SCCM 站点,所以尽管我很乐意自己尝试解决更多问题,但我可能会花几个小时纠结于此,不知道下一步该怎么做!

很感谢任何形式的帮助!

干杯,

奥利弗

答案1

看起来 SCCM 安装有点问题。CCMExec.exe 已损坏,甚至网站重置也无济于事。我恢复了几个月前的安装磁盘备份,现在一切正常

相关内容